Abstract
يتعلق الاختراع الحالي بكابل ألياف ضوئية optical fiber cable يتضمن لب core يتضمن ألياف ضوئية مجمعة gathered optical fibers، غلاف داخلي inner sheath يستوعب اللب داخله، جسم سلك wire body مضمن في الغلاف الداخلي، زوج من أعضاء شد tension members مضمنة في الغلاف الداخلي مع اللب المقحم بينهما، رقاقة دعم reinforcing sheet تغطي الغلاف الداخلي وجسم السلك، وغلاف خارجي outer sheath يغطي رقاقة الدعم التي تشمل الغلاف الداخلي، عندما يكون سمك جزء داخلي نصف قطري radially inner portion من جسم السلك عبارة عن ti، يكون سمك جزء داخلي نصف قطري من زوج أعضاء الشد عبارة عن Ti، يكون سمك جزء خارجي نصف قطري radially outer portion من جسم السلك عبارة عن to، ويكون سمك جزء خارجي نصف قطري من زوج أعضاء الشد عبارة عن To، يتم استيفاء ti < Ti وto < To. شكل1
